Output ecc861693945582824b80a8a5b93effce8fddbc793ccdec70f098320cfc67aae:15

value
25439964
script pubkey
OP_0 OP_PUSHBYTES_20 1d20487e77a9bb5dc786b67f86671089a865f2c5
address
ltc1qr5syslnh4xa4m3uxkelcvecs3x5xtuk9a6npuy
transaction
ecc861693945582824b80a8a5b93effce8fddbc793ccdec70f098320cfc67aae
spent
true